Kangiqsualujjuaq
Is an Inuit village with a population of less than 1000, located on the east coast of Ungava Bay at the mouth of the George River, in Nunavik, Quebec, Canada.
Industries in Kangiqsualujjuaq include hunting of caribou, seal and beluga whale, arctic char fishing, and the production of Inuit art.
